> I realize we have not discussed this in some time.  Here's what's happening 
> to me.
> 
> I find that, when ever I have at least three apps open, and I go to check my 
> mail, I cannot expand threads by using the right arrow key as I usually do.  
> I am acustomed to expanding a thread with the right arrow, then, arrowing 
> down to the oldest message in the thread.  Then, to read the text, I just 
> press VO+j.  This causes interaction with the message content table.  
> However, when at least three apps are open, and I try to expand a message 
> thread, I hear the bong sound wich tells me that I cannot do this.  At that 
> point, my only choice is to use control+tab to at least look at the messages 
> I want to look at in the thread.  Just arrowing to a thread and pressing 
> return on it does not work.  Any other suggestions?  I've already contacted 
> Apple Accessibility about this and not so much as an  acknowledgment as I 
> used to get.
> 
> Going full screen does not help nor does bringing all to the front.  Pressing 
> zoom does not help either.
